How to choose the right business structure for your company

Choosing the right business structure is a crucial decision when starting a company. The structure you choose will impact various aspects of your business, including liability, taxes, and decision-making processes. With various options available, it can be overwhelming to determine which structure is the best fit for your company. In this article, we will discuss how to choose the right business structure for your company and explain the different options available.

One important consideration when selecting a business structure is liability. Some structures, such as sole proprietorships and general partnerships, offer little to no separation between the business and the owner’s personal assets. This means that the owner is personally liable for the debts and obligations of the business. On the other hand, structures like limited liability companies (LLCs) and corporations provide limited liability protection, shielding the owner’s personal assets from business debts.

Another crucial factor to consider when choosing a business structure is taxes. Depending on the structure you choose, your business may be subject to different tax treatments. For example, sole proprietorships and partnerships are taxed at the individual level, meaning business profits are reported on the owner’s personal tax return. In contrast, corporations are subject to corporate taxes, which can result in double taxation if dividends are distributed to shareholders. LLCs offer more flexibility in tax treatment, allowing owners to choose how they want to be taxed.

Additionally, the decision-making process within the company can be influenced by its structure. In a sole proprietorship, the owner has complete control over decision-making. However, in a partnership or corporation, decision-making may be shared among multiple owners or shareholders. This can lead to conflicts if there are disagreements on important business matters. It is important to consider how decisions will be made within the company and whether the chosen structure aligns with your goals and values.

When choosing a business structure, it is essential to consider the long-term goals of the company. For example, if you plan to seek external funding or eventually go public, a corporation may be the most suitable structure. On the other hand, if you want a simple and flexible structure with limited liability protection, an LLC may be a better fit. It is also important to consider the specific requirements and regulations in your industry, as some structures may be more suitable than others.
